引言
在Windows 7操作系统中,用户可能会遇到“适配器无本地连接”的问题,这通常是由于网络适配器设置或驱动程序问题导致的。本文将详细探讨这一问题的原因,并提供一系列解决方案。
问题原因分析
- 网络适配器驱动程序损坏或未安装:这是最常见的原因之一。如果网络适配器的驱动程序损坏或未安装,系统将无法识别网络适配器。
- 网络适配器硬件故障:硬件故障也可能导致网络适配器无法正常工作。
- 网络策略阻止连接:某些网络策略可能阻止了本地连接的建立。
- 系统设置错误:例如,某些网络设置可能被错误地配置,导致无法建立本地连接。
解决方案
1. 检查网络适配器驱动程序
步骤:
- 打开“设备管理器”。
- 展开网络适配器类别。
- 查看是否有带有黄色问号或感叹号的设备。
- 如果有,右键点击该设备,选择“更新驱动程序软件”。
- 选择“自动搜索更新的驱动程序软件”。
- 如果自动搜索失败,尝试手动下载并安装驱动程序。
代码示例(适用于Windows批处理):
@echo off
cd /d "%~dp0"
pushd "C:\Path\To\Driver"
driverquery /si /f *.* | findstr "网络适配器" > nul
if errorlevel 1 (
echo 网络适配器驱动程序不存在,请先安装驱动程序。
) else (
echo 网络适配器驱动程序存在,请检查驱动程序是否正常。
)
popd
pause
2. 检查网络适配器硬件
- 断开并重新连接网络适配器。
- 如果是内置网络适配器,尝试使用外置网络适配器进行测试。
- 如果是外置网络适配器,尝试使用其他计算机的USB端口进行测试。
3. 检查网络策略
- 打开“本地安全策略”。
- 转到“网络策略和访问控制”。
- 查看是否有阻止本地连接的策略。
4. 重置网络设置
- 打开“命令提示符”(以管理员身份运行)。
- 输入以下命令并按Enter:
netsh winsock reset netsh int ip reset - 重启计算机。
总结
通过上述步骤,您可以解决Windows 7系统中适配器无本地连接的问题。如果问题仍然存在,可能需要考虑硬件故障或更复杂的问题,建议联系专业技术人员进行诊断和修复。
